Day005

包机制

 

包的本质就是文件夹

为了更好的组织类

包的语法格式为:

package pkg1[.pkg2[.pkg3....]]

一般包名为公司域名的倒置

 

导包

import 包名

 

javaDoc

javaDoc命令是用于生成自己的API文档的

JavaDoc -encoding utf-8 -charset utf-8 文件名

image-20210828214405096

 

流程控制

基础阶段

  1. 用户交互Scanner类

  2. 顺序结构

  3. 选择结构

  4. 循环结构

  5. break &continue

  6. 练习

 

Sacnner类

作用:获取用户的输入

 

基本语法:Scanner s=new Scanner(System.in);

可以用两种方法 next(),nextLine()来判断接收

 

next()

  1. 一定要读取到有效的字符后才会结束输入

  2. 对输入的有效字符前的空白进行自动去除

  3. 只有输入有效字符后才交期后面的空白作为分隔符或者结束符

  4. next()不能得到带有空格的字符串

import java.util.Scanner;

public class Demo001 {
   public static void main(String[] args) {
       //创建一个扫描器对象
       Scanner scanner =new Scanner(System.in);
       System.out.println("使用next方式接收:");
       if (scanner.hasNext()){
           //使用使用next方式接收
           String str =scanner.next();
           System.out.println("输出的内容为:"+str);
      }
  }
}

 

 

nextLin()

  1. 是以Enter为结束符,也就是说nextLine()方法的返回是输入回车之前的所有内容

  2. 可以获得空白和带有空白的字符

import java.util.Scanner;

public class Demo002 {
   public static void main(String[] args) {
       Scanner scanner=new Scanner(System.in);
       System.out.println("使用hasNestLine接收:");
       if (scanner.hasNextLine()){
           String str =scanner.nextLine();
           System.out.println("输出为:"+str);
      }
       scanner.close();
  }
}

 

 

 

 

 

 

 

 

 

posted @ 2021-08-28 22:17  杨航94  阅读(28)  评论(0)    收藏  举报